The expertise surrounding plastic gaskets lies not just in their application, but in their production. Manufacturing these components involves precision engineering and material science to meet specific industry standards. Common materials used in creating plastic gaskets include PTFE, nylon, and polyethylene, each selected based on the required resistance to heat, chemicals, or pressure. Advanced manufacturing techniques ensure that these gaskets meet the stringent specifications necessary for optimal performance. This technical knowledge underscores the importance of selecting the right type of gasket for the job, as failure to do so can compromise the entire system’s efficacy.

Authoritative insights into their use underscore that plastic gaskets are critical in sealing joints to prevent leaks, which could potentially lead to costly failures or hazards, such as in gas pipelines or hydraulic systems. In addition, they serve an essential role in electrical systems by providing insulating barriers, thus preventing unwanted conductive paths. In the automotive industry, they contribute to reducing noise, vibration, and harshness (NVH), enhancing the overall comfort and safety of vehicles.
